Vaccine Hesitancy Campaign Call For Artists

The MCAC vaccine hesitancy campaign seeks to provide honest and accurate information to encourage Immigrant, BIPOC, Disability and LGBTQIA+ communities in Greater Manchester to make an empowered choice to get vaccinated. The campaign seeks to provide information about local vaccine clinics that are open to all by using creative and connective ways to share accurate information about the COVID vaccine’s safety and effectiveness.

We are seeking artists from diverse backgrounds to share their talents to create graphics and short videos (30 seconds to 1 minute) to be included as a part of our digital and in-person community campaign and future community art show.

All submissions will be included in the future community art show. Selected graphics and short videos that are included in the community campaign will receive a stipend of $150.
